Serum concentrations of vitamins in CKD patients
| Vitamin | CKD | |||||
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Stage 1 | Stage 2 | Stage 3 | Stage 4 | Stage 5 | ||
| Vit A (µM) | 0.69 (0.54, 0.92) | 0.73 (0.60, 0.98) | 0.85 (0.64, 1.04) | 0.81 (0.67, 1.03) | 1.01 (0.77, 1.34) | 0.000 |
| Vit B1 (nM) | 82.91 (76.47, 91.04) | 87.27 (77.65, 97.09) | 86.11 (78.77, 95.79) | 89.33 (80.49, 101.68) | 83.81 (76.87, 92.79) | 0.004 |
| Vit B2 (nM) | 11.50 (10.73, 12.36) | 11.37 (10.68, 12.43) | 11.29 (10.63, 12.30) | 10.84 (10.26, 11.77) | 11.05 (10.47, 12.01) | 0.000 |
| Vit B6 (nM) | 31.30 (29.67, 33.12) | 31.46 (29.44, 32.93) | 31.28 (29.16, 33.21) | 32.11 (29.16, 34.02) | 33.67 (30.98, 34.92) | 0.000 |
| Vit B9 (nM) | 20.51 (15.76, 24.88) | 18.51 (14.76, 24.65) | 18.2 (13.97, 23.45) | 19.34 (15.41, 24.85) | 19.24 (14.35, 23.87) | 0.150 |
| Vit B12 (pM) | 418.5 (361.7, 448.1) | 403.0 (363.0, 445.3) | 390.4 (355.3, 430.8) | 417.3 (381.2, 445.3) | 438.2 (390.0, 464.7) | 0.000 |
| Vit C (µM) | 35.44 (33.29, 38.96) | 35.54 (34.04, 37.76) | 35.82 (33.46, 38.38) | 35.7 (34.37, 38.66) | 36.36 (34.35, 38.45) | 0.733 |
| Vit D (nM) | 35.68 (29.41, 42.47) | 35.65 (30.03, 42.29) | 35.24 (28.80, 40.78) | 30.01 (24.74, 34.98) | 26.12 (20.86, 30.27) | 0.000 |
| Vit E (µM) | 25.72(25.03, 26.37) | 25.98 (25.17, 26.58) | 25.66 (24.96, 26.51) | 25.56 (24.98, 26.33) | 25.84 (25.10, 26.75) | 0.177 |
Note: data were expressed as median (IQR)

The correlation and regression analysis between different vitamins and estimated glomerular filtration rate (eGFR)
| Variable | Pearson correlation | Multiple linear regression | |||
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Coefficient | Parameter | SE of parameter | |||
| Vit A | -0.21766 | < 0.0001 | -23.45440 | 3.63941 | < 0.0001 |
| Vit B1 | -0.07844 | 0.0307 | -0.20342 | 0.09237 | 0.0280 |
| Vit B2 | 0.08720 | 0.0163 | 0.69456 | 1.98502 | 0.7265 |
| Vit B6 | -0.06300 | 0.0828 | -0.12628 | 0.31433 | 0.6880 |
| Vit B9 | 0.06546 | 0.0715 | 0.33561 | 0.21735 | 0.1230 |
| Vit B12 | -0.05781 | 0.1115 | ---- | ---- | ---- |
| Vit C | -0.03097 | 0.3943 | ---- | ---- | ---- |
| Vit D | 0.19752 | < 0.0001 | 0.46360 | 0.09356 | < 0.0001 |
| Vit E | 0.00177 | 0.9611 | ---- | ---- | ---- |
| Intercept | ---- | ---- | 76.19669 | 16.60018 | < 0.0001 |
Fig. 1The correlation between vitamins and estimated glomerular filtration rate (eGFR). A, inverse correlation between vitamin A and eGFR. Pearson correlation coefficient is -0.21766 (p < 0.0001); B, inverse correlation between vitamin B1 and eGFR. Pearson correlation coefficient is -0.07844 (p = 0.0307); C, correlation between vitamin B2 and eGFR. Pearson correlation coefficient is 0.08720 (p = 0.0163); D, correlation between vitamin D and eGFR. Pearson correlation coefficient is -0.19752 (p < 0.0001)
